Public Relations Specialist
Location: Remote
About Instructional Empowerment:
Instructional Empowerment partners with educators and communities to transform schools and improve student outcomes. We focus on empowering leadership, strengthening instructional practices, and expanding opportunities for all students to succeed in education.
Position Summary:
The Public Relations Specialist will develop and execute PR strategies to elevate our brand, increase visibility, and enhance reputation. This role requires expertise in media relations, content creation, and analytics to improve brand awareness and public perception.
Key Responsibilities:
PR Strategy: Develop and execute data-driven strategies, press releases, and media materials; build relationships with media outlets.
Content Development: Create engaging digital content, blogs, case studies, and success stories.
Collaboration & Reporting: Work with internal teams for cohesive messaging, track PR performance, and analyze campaign results.
